Switchboards, also called circuit box or electrical panels, are vital elements of any electrical system. They distribute power throughout your home or company, protecting it from overloading and short circuits. With time, switchboards can end up being outdated, inefficient, or unsafe. If your switchboard is showing indications of wear and tear, it may be time for an upgrade.

Security is a worry about older switchboards that might not depend on current safety standards, potentially raising the danger of electrical fires or shocks. Updating to a more contemporary switchboard can enhance the efficiency of your electrical system, leading to decreased energy usage and expenses. If you have just recently added new home appliances or electrical circuits, your current switchboard may do not have the necessary capability. In addition, certain insurance provider mandate that properties have contemporary switchboards. These are some key considerations when considering a switchboard upgrade.

Updating a switchboard normally involves the setup of a new one that present safety regulations and can accommodating your electrical requirements. Additional steps in the process may include:

Circuit Breaker Replacement: Replacing old breaker with newer, more efficient models.

Circuitry Replacement: Changing out-of-date or damaged wiring to enhance security and effectiveness.

Additional Circuits: Including brand-new circuits to accommodate extra appliances or electrical loads.

Security Gadgets: Installing safety devices such as rise protectors or recurring present devices (RCDs).

The Cost of a Switchboard Upgrade

Switchboard Upgrade Expenses What Aspects Impact the Cost?

The expense of changing a larger switchboard is typically greater. Upgrades that work, like rewiring or installing brand-new circuits, will also increase the expense. In addition, the overall expense may vary based on the area and the labor and products.
